    broken case exracter.

    does any one know how to use either of the 45/70's early or the later one to extract the separated case out of the SPRINGFOELD TRAP DOOR GUN? I have both and not a clue on how to use them> and also I have a thing that screwed onto the ramrod that looks like a small thimble with serrations on it, it fits on an 1873 rod, any one? thanks.

    Anyway, the rod is a wiping rod, and not a ramrod, the end set up to accept cleaning patches.

    The extractor gets inserted into the rear of the broken shell, and the trapdoor closed in order to "seat it".

    The trapdoor is then opened and the cleaning rod/bayonet used from the muzzle to force the extractor out along with the broken shell casing.
